Everyone is still talking about Yahoo’s latest news-making acquisition —  for this very social blogging platform! On Monday, the company’s board approved a $1.1 billion all-cash deal to acquire Tumblr. As the world welcomes its newest 26-year-old billionaire, Tumblr founder David Karp, we thought you might enjoy watching this flashback from our friends at All Things D: A 2007 interview they conducted with Karp back when he was raising his very first round of venture funding for the site.

Everyone, I’m elated to tell you that Tumblr will be joining Yahoo.

Before touching on how awesome this is, let me try to allay any concerns: We’re not turning purple. Our headquarters isn’t moving. Our team isn’t changing. Our roadmap isn’t changing. And our mission – to empower creators to…
